Detailed Description: Membranous nephropathy (MN) is a common cause of nephrotic syndrome in adults. It is thought to be mainly a primary or idiopathic form; however, it may also be secondary to many other diseases (e.g., infections, drugs, neoplasms and autoimmune diseases). In this study, the presence of Helicobacter Pylori antigen was investigated in renal tissue from needle biopsy samples, and the prevalence of H. pylori infection and the effects of H. pylori eradication on proteinuria level in patients with MN will be investigated.
